# Approvals — ParcelPing Webhook

Changes to the parcel-tracking webhook require approval before deploy, including retry-policy tweaks and payload schema edits. On-call engineers may push an emergency disable without prior approval, but must file a retro ticket within one hour. Carrier-mapping updates always need a staging replay first. For anything ambiguous during an incident, page the approver directly rather than guessing:

named custodian: Brivan Eliath Quenox Frador

MEMO — All Branch Managers

Subject: Pilot with Harrowvale Stores

Starting next month, twelve Harrowvale Stores locations will stock our Quillbird range under a six-week pilot. Branches in the Derrinmoor region should expect increased replenishment requests and route a weekly stock report to regional ops. Do not discuss terms with Harrowvale staff; all commercial questions go through Marta Evenlow's team. Full rollout depends on pilot sell-through. The strategic context for this pilot is summarised below.

confidential, bafop-kahag: Gross margin on Ulawyn came in at 15 percent against a plan of 10 percent. Only 5 of the 80 pilot accounts renewed Ulawyn, so a churn review is set for January 1.

## Tuning

FeeCrafter's rules engine decides shipping fees per order, and yes, the defaults are opinionated. If a merchant on the Parcelgrove plan complains about weird surcharges, it's almost always one of the knobs below rather than a bug. Changing a value takes effect on the next rule reload, so no restart needed — just don't crank the distance multiplier without checking with eng. Current defaults follow.

tuning table, kageg-kagap:
CAPS = {
    "druox": 842,
    "quenax": 605,
    "zormir": 107,
    "tamwyn": 577,
    "kasok": 688,
}

Runbook: Seat-map renderer recovery (Ovelle Theatre Tools)

Hey reviewer — if the renderer's admin account gets locked after failed canvas-cache resets, don't just retry; that extends the lockout. Instead, hit the recovery flow on the Ovelle staging box and pick "operator reset." It'll ask for the team recovery passphrase, which is kept right below this note.

vault phrase of yahap-kajof = fraath-ralael